Replying to: hlj7 (Apr 30, 2006 6:06 am) Of all the electrical equipment in your car, they can have the largest influence on your gas mileage. They can also be expensive. MAP sensors used by the millions in GM cars can go for less than $100. A common Japanese MAF could be a little over $200. Some racing and obscure European MAFs can be over $500. One thing they all have in common is they should be cheap to install. A mechanically inclined person should be able to change most of them in 30 minutes. |
